在端点禁用以太网流量控制

网络工程 以太网 tcp 协议论 传输协议
2022-03-01 21:17:14

对于通过 Internet 访问资源的应用程序,我们遇到了一些与断开连接、冻结、Web 会话重置和其他愚蠢问题有关的问题。我最大的问题是使用 RCP over HTTPS(MS Outlook)的前景。我希望这是因为我们的互联网连接超载。更重要的是,即使带宽使用率很低,Outlook 也会出现问题。

我正在帮助解决另一个问题,并碰巧注意到交换机的以太网端口上禁用了 Flow-Control(我知道这是默认设置,我只是从未真正考虑过)。好吧,大多数计算机默认启用它。只是因为我之前没有尝试过,所以我在我的计算机上禁用了以太网流量控制,现在 Outlook 和我的其他 Internet 可访问应用程序正常工作(没有断开连接、重置或会话丢失)。如果没有更多信息,我不想在其他领域测试这种变化,所以我有几个问题。这是侥幸吗,如果不是,为什么会发生这种情况,这是否意味着我需要增加缓冲区?还有什么我可能会丢失的吗?

我已经在 Windows 7 中运行 perfmon,查看 NIC 和数据包出站和接收错误,如果有的话,通常非常低。

1个回答

这是侥幸吗?

大概。

这是否意味着我需要增加缓冲区?

您禁用了流量控制,因此如果是缓冲区溢出问题,这会使问题变得更糟。错误计数器应该告诉您是否有任何问题。

流控制是一种协商功能。如果开关将其“关闭”(发送接收),则连接的设备也应将其禁用。当然,这是假设您的网卡、驱动程序和交换机已损坏。